WebSep 28, 2024 · Iritis tends to be the mildest type of uveitis and often occurs in otherwise healthy people. It primarily affects people ages 20 to 60 and makes up about 50 to 70 percent of all uveitis cases. WebApr 2, 2024 · Iritis is inflammation of your iris. The iris is the colored part of your eye. Viruses, bacteria, and fungi are common causes of iritis. An eye injury or certain medicines may cause inflammation. You may develop iritis if you have an autoimmune disease, such as inflammatory bowel disease or psoriatic arthritis.

WebMar 3, 2024 · First described by Fuchs in 1906, Fuchs heterochromic iridocyclitis (FHI) is a chronic, unilateral iridocyclitis characterized by iris heterochromia. Fuchs speculated that an unknown process leads to the development of abnormal uveal pigment with chronic low-grade inflammation, eventually causing iris atrophy and secondary glaucoma.
